| package org.apache.servicecomb.governance; |
| |
| import java.net.ConnectException; |
| import java.util.concurrent.atomic.AtomicInteger; |
| |
| import org.apache.servicecomb.governance.handler.InstanceIsolationHandler; |
| import org.apache.servicecomb.governance.marker.GovernanceRequest; |
| import org.junit.jupiter.api.Assertions; |
| import org.junit.jupiter.api.Test; |
| import org.springframework.beans.factory.annotation.Autowired; |
| import org.springframework.boot.test.context.SpringBootTest; |
| import org.springframework.test.context.ContextConfiguration; |
| |
| import io.github.resilience4j.circuitbreaker.CallNotPermittedException; |
| import io.github.resilience4j.circuitbreaker.CircuitBreaker; |
| import io.github.resilience4j.decorators.Decorators; |
| import io.github.resilience4j.decorators.Decorators.DecorateCheckedSupplier; |
| import io.micrometer.core.instrument.MeterRegistry; |
| import io.micrometer.prometheus.PrometheusMeterRegistry; |
| |
| @SpringBootTest |
| @ContextConfiguration(classes = {GovernanceConfiguration.class, MockConfiguration.class}) |
| public class InstanceIsolationTest { |
| private InstanceIsolationHandler instanceIsolationHandler; |
| |
| private MeterRegistry meterRegistry; |
| |
| @Autowired |
| public void setInstanceIsolationHandler(InstanceIsolationHandler instanceIsolationHandler, |
| MeterRegistry meterRegistry) { |
| this.instanceIsolationHandler = instanceIsolationHandler; |
| this.meterRegistry = meterRegistry; |
| } |
| |
| @Test |
| public void test_instance_isolation_work() throws Throwable { |
| AtomicInteger counter = new AtomicInteger(0); |
| |
| DecorateCheckedSupplier<Object> ds = Decorators.ofCheckedSupplier(() -> { |
| int run = counter.getAndIncrement(); |
| if (run == 0) { |
| return "test"; |
| } |
| if (run == 1) { |
| throw new ConnectException("test exception"); |
| } |
| return "test"; |
| }); |
| |
| DecorateCheckedSupplier<Object> ds2 = Decorators.ofCheckedSupplier(() -> "test"); |
| |
| GovernanceRequest request = new GovernanceRequest(); |
| request.setInstanceId("instance01"); |
| request.setServiceName("service01"); |
| request.setUri("/test"); |
| |
| CircuitBreaker circuitBreaker = instanceIsolationHandler.getActuator(request); |
| ds.withCircuitBreaker(circuitBreaker); |
| |
| // isolation from error |
| Assertions.assertEquals("test", ds.get()); |
| Assertions.assertThrows(ConnectException.class, ds::get); |
| |
| Assertions.assertThrows(CallNotPermittedException.class, ds::get); |
| Assertions.assertThrows(CallNotPermittedException.class, ds::get); |
| |
| Assertions.assertThrows(CallNotPermittedException.class, ds::get); |
| Assertions.assertThrows(CallNotPermittedException.class, ds::get); |
| Assertions.assertThrows(CallNotPermittedException.class, ds::get); |
| |
| // isolation do not influence other instances |
| GovernanceRequest request2 = new GovernanceRequest(); |
| request2.setInstanceId("instance02"); |
| request2.setServiceName("service01"); |
| request2.setUri("/test"); |
| |
| CircuitBreaker circuitBreaker2 = instanceIsolationHandler.getActuator(request2); |
| ds2.withCircuitBreaker(circuitBreaker2); |
| |
| Assertions.assertEquals("test", ds2.get()); |
| Assertions.assertEquals("test", ds2.get()); |
| Assertions.assertEquals("test", ds2.get()); |
| Assertions.assertEquals("test", ds2.get()); |
| |
| assertMetricsNotFinish(); |
| |
| // recover from isolation |
| Thread.sleep(1000); |
| |
| Assertions.assertEquals("test", ds.get()); |
| Assertions.assertEquals("test", ds.get()); |
| Assertions.assertEquals("test", ds2.get()); |
| Assertions.assertEquals("test", ds2.get()); |
| |
| assertMetricsFinish(); |
| } |
| |
| private void assertMetricsNotFinish() { |
| String result = ((PrometheusMeterRegistry) meterRegistry).scrape();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_state{name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ance01\",state=\"open\",} 1.0"));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_state{name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ance02\",state=\"closed\",} 1.0"));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_calls_seconds_count{kind=\"successful\",name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ance01\",} 1.0"));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_calls_seconds_count{kind=\"successful\",name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ance02\",} 4.0")); |
| } |
| |
| private void assertMetricsFinish() { |
| String result = ((PrometheusMeterRegistry) meterRegistry).scrape();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_state{name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ance01\",state=\"closed\",} 1.0"));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_state{name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ance02\",state=\"closed\",} 1.0"));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_calls_seconds_count{kind=\"successful\",name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ance01\",} 3.0")); |
| Assertions.assertTrue(result.contains( |
| "resilience4j_circuitbreaker_calls_seconds_count{kind=\"successful\",name=\"servicecomb.instanceIsolation.service01.demo-allOperation.instance02\",} 6.0")); |
| } |
| } |
